Bathroom Fan Installation Prices in Texas
Average prices based on local market data. Actual prices may vary by city and scope.
| Service | Price Range |
|---|---|
Replace existing bathroom fan (same size) Remove old fan, install new unit in existing housing | $150-$350 |
New fan installation with ductwork Cut ceiling opening, run duct to exterior, wire and install | $350-$700 |
Fan-light-heater combo installation Multi-function unit with dedicated switch wiring | $300-$600 |
Duct reroute to exterior wall or roof Redirect duct from attic to proper exterior vent | $200-$450 |
Humidity-sensing fan upgrade Auto-activating fan with built-in humidity sensor | $250-$500 |
Inline fan installation for long duct runs Remote-mounted fan for bathrooms far from exterior walls | $400-$800 |
Frequently Asked Questions
How much does bathroom fan installation cost in Texas?
Replacing an existing fan costs $150 to $350 in Texas when the housing and ductwork are already in place. Installing a brand-new fan where none exists costs $350 to $700 because it requires cutting a ceiling opening, running ductwork to an exterior vent, and wiring the switch. Combo units with lights or heaters run $300 to $600 installed.
Is a bathroom exhaust fan required by code in Texas?
Texas follows the International Residential Code, which requires mechanical ventilation in bathrooms without an operable window. Even bathrooms with windows benefit from an exhaust fan because Texas humidity levels make natural ventilation insufficient for preventing mold. Most local building codes require a minimum 50 CFM fan for standard bathrooms.
What size exhaust fan do I need?
The standard rule is one CFM per square foot of bathroom floor area, with a minimum of 50 CFM. A typical 8-by-10-foot bathroom needs an 80 CFM fan. For bathrooms with separate shower enclosures, jetted tubs, or steam showers, you need higher CFM ratings. A professional will calculate the exact requirement based on your bathroom dimensions and features.
Why is my bathroom fan so loud?
Noisy bathroom fans are usually older models rated at 3 to 4 sones. Modern fans operate at 0.3 to 1.0 sones and are nearly silent. Other causes of noise include loose mounting hardware, debris in the fan blades, a worn-out motor, or undersized ductwork creating back pressure. Replacing an old fan with a modern unit dramatically reduces noise.
Can a bathroom fan vent into the attic?
No. Venting a bathroom fan into the attic is a code violation in Texas and a common source of moisture damage. The warm, humid air condenses on cold attic surfaces, causing mold growth and wood rot. All exhaust fans must vent to the building exterior through a wall cap or roof vent. If your fan vents into the attic, it should be rerouted immediately.
How long does bathroom fan installation take?
Replacing an existing fan in the same housing takes one to two hours. A new installation requiring ceiling cutting, duct routing, and electrical wiring takes three to five hours depending on attic access and the distance to the nearest exterior wall. Most installations are completed in a single visit with cleanup included.
